Web27 de abr. de 2024 · A well pump generator size depends on your pump’s rating. Thus, you must determine your pump’s voltage requirement and horsepower rating first. Convert horsepower to watts by multiplying the constant value 746 with the horsepower. If you have a 1.5HP pump, the corresponding wattage is 1119 watts. Web7 de abr. de 2024 · The size of the generator to run a furnace depends on the wattage requirement of the furnace, ranging from 1,000-20,000 watts. As a general rule, a generator with a capacity of at least 5,000 watts is usually sufficient to run a furnace.
